To change the following options, go to the Configure menu:
Note: After joining the group, you cannot change the settings.
Wireless mode (802.11 a/b/g)
For a wireless LAN adapter supporting multiple network types (for
example, a, b, and g), you can switch between the modes used in
Adhoc networking. The wireless adapter specifies the default mode.
Received Files folder path
You must have write access authorization to change this setting.
To start a secure mode connection, enable IP security while connected. You
must configure your computer first, and then enable IP security. The
procedure is as follows:
v If your computer is running Windows XP with SP2 preloaded on it, install
the Windows Support Tools (C:\Support\Tools). Open the
C:\Support\Tools directory and double-click SETUP.EXE. Follow the
instructions presented by the Setup Wizard. When you are asked to
select the installation type, select Complete.
v If your computer is running Windows XP upgraded with SP2, go to the
Microsoft Download Center (http://www.microsoft.com/downloads), and
search for "Windows XP Service Pack 2 Support Tools." Download the
program into your temporary directory and execute it. Follow the
instructions presented by the Setup Wizard. When you are asked to
select the installation type, select Complete.
v If your machine is running Windows XP, and SP2 has not been installed,
follow the installation procedure given for a computer running Windows
XP with SP2 preloaded on it.
v If you have installed the OS yourself, insert the installation CD for
Windows XP. If the setup program starts automatically, exit it and open
the \Support\Tools directory using Windows Explorer. Then double-click
SETUP.EXE, and follow the instructions presented by the Setup Wizard.
When you are asked to select the installation type, select Complete.
v If your computer is running Windows 2000, go to the Windows 2000
Resource Kit Download page
(http://www.microsoft.com/windows2000/techinfo/reskit/tools), and
download "Ipsecpol.exe: Internet Protocol Security Policies Tool" to your
temporary directory. You can then run that program to set up
IPSecPol.exe.
